## Onboarding: Profile Store Sharding (Lanternfish)

The user-profile store is sharded sixteen ways by a stable hash of the account identifier. Resharding is rare and always done via the Harborline rebalancer, never by hand. Each shard's replication stream is authenticated, so new maintainers must register before pushing topology changes. Schema migrations are applied shard-by-shard with a canary on shard 0 first. All topology commits are verified against the key below.

signing key of bagap-yawep = bky13_TbfT6ZMUoGJo2

### Runbook: Stale-Branch Cleanup Bot

The Twigsnip bot runs nightly and flags branches in the Larkmoor monorepo untouched for 60 days. It opens a deletion ticket first; nothing is removed without a seven-day grace window. New team members should review the exclusion list before editing schedules. The bot records its audit trail in the ops database, connecting via the value below.

primary connection of kahof-kagep = mssql://belath_svc:3uqY4g6LHG5Nyi@db-d0ba.ferralabs.corp:5432/rusdor

### Audit Item 14 — Stale-Cache Postmortem Follow-ups

Hey plugin folks: confirm your extension respects the new cache-invalidation headers introduced after the Murkfield stale-cache incident. Plugins pinning old render output caused most of the weirdness, so double-check your TTL handling and re-run the conformance suite. Once you've verified, get sign-off from the postmortem action-item owner, whose name appears below.

account owner for bawip-tahag: Raleth Quenok

## Support

Pagination in the Kestrel Commerce API uses opaque cursors; do not attempt to construct or decode them. Cursors expire after 24 hours, so long-running exports should checkpoint regularly. Known edge cases are tracked in the API changelog. If you hit a cursor error not covered there, send details to the API support team.

alerts address for taduf-bafog: wenwyn.briiel.praix@crelvogrid.corp